PMAY 2.0 helps families (husband, wife, and children) purchase their first pucca (permanent) home
Eligible beneficiaries receive a ₹1.8 lakh subsidy, credited in five instalments directly to their loan account.*
To promote women’s empowerment, the house must be fully or partially owned by a female family member.
Maximum Property Value: ₹35 lakh
Maximum Carpet Area: 120 sq. meters
Location: Approved urban towns only
Minimum loan tenure: 5 years
Maximum loan amount eligible for subsidy: ₹25 lakh
Applicable for loans sanctioned on or after 01.09.2024
Subsidy on first ₹8 lakh for a tenure upto 12 years
Households with an annual income below ₹9 lakh qualify for the scheme.
